Removing the Display Assembly

1. Follow the instructions in Before You Begin.
2. Remove the battery (see Removing the Battery).
3. Remove the keyboard (see Removing the Keyboard).
4. Follow the instructions from step 4 to step 6 in Removing the Hard Drive.
5. Remove the palm rest (see Removing the Palm Rest).
6. Disconnect the Mini-Card antenna cables from the Mini-Card(s).
7. Make note of the cable routing and carefully dislodge the Mini-Card antenna cables from the routing guides.
8. Disconnect the display cable from the system board connector.
9. Remove the two screws (one on each side) that secure the display assembly to the computer base.
10. Lift and remove the display assembly off the computer base.
